Home foundation repair services focus on addressing issues related to the structural base of a property. These services typically involve assessing the foundation’s condition, identifying areas of damage or instability, and implementing solutions to restore stability. Common repair methods include underpinning, slabjacking, pier installation, and crack sealing. The goal is to ensure the foundation remains secure and level, which is vital for the overall safety and integrity of the building.
The primary problems that foundation repair services help resolve include settling, cracking, shifting, and water intrusion. Over time, soil movement, poor drainage, or improper construction can cause the foundation to weaken or shift. This can lead to uneven floors, sticking doors and windows, and visible cracks in walls or the foundation itself. Repairing these issues not only stabilizes the structure but also helps prevent further damage that could compromise the property's safety and value.

Foundation Repair Costs - The typical cost for foundation repair services ranges from $2,000 to $7,000, depending on the extent of damage. Minor cracks may cost around $2,000, while significant foundation work can exceed $7,000. Costs vary based on the repair method and property size.
Crack Repair Expenses - Repairing foundation cracks generally costs between $500 and $2,500. Small cracks might be repaired for approximately $500, whereas larger or multiple cracks can increase the total to over $2,000. The severity of the cracks influences the overall price.
Pier and Beam Foundation Costs - Installing or repairing pier and beam foundations typically ranges from $3,000 to $10,000. Basic repairs may start around $3,000, with more extensive projects reaching higher amounts depending on the size and complexity of the work needed. What are common signs of foundation issues? Indicators include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ven or sloping surfaces, doors and windows that stick or don't close properly, and gaps around window frames or doorways.
How is foundation damage typically repaired? Repairs often involve methods like underpinning, piering, or slab stabilization, performed by local contractors experienced in foundation restoration.
Can foundation problems be prevented? Regular inspections and addressing minor issues early can help prevent major foundation damage, though some factors like soil conditions are beyond control.
What is the typical process for assessing foundation issues? A professional contractor conducts a visual inspection, evaluates structural movement, and may use specialized tools to determine the extent of damage.
How long do foundation repairs usually take? Repair durations vary depending on the severity of the damage and the chosen method, with most projects lasting from a few days to a few weeks.
